Where a pastoral lease is adversely affected by a disaster or a lessee is suffering personal financial hardship as a result of poor economic conditions in the pastoral industry, the PLB under section 128 of the Land Administration Act 1997 may recommend to the Minister that the lessee be granted an appropriate level of rent relief.. Potential Carrying Capacity is the estimated number of livestock equivalents that can be carried annually over the long-term on a lease while maintaining or improving rangeland condition. Crown grants. A Crown grant was defined by the Lands Act 1898 as a deed issued in the name of Her Majesty conveying some portion of Crown land in fee simple, otherwise known as Freehold title.
